Key Ingredients
- Cherry Tomatoes: We designed it as a cherry tomato salad, but you can use a variety of tomatoes. Make sure they are ripe, sweet and juicy.
- vinegar: Use red wine vinegar, white wine vinegar, champagne vinegar or balsamic vinegar. They are all delicious!
- Oregano: This cherry tomato salad was inspired by our Greek salad recipe, so I used a lot of dried oregano. I like it!
- olive oil: Use your favorite kind. It will combine with tomato sauce to make a delicious dressing.
- Salt and pepper: The trick to the best tomato salad is to add salt in advance. You’ll see me saying the same thing on all the tomato salad recipes we share (it’s a Caprese salad). Salt absorbs the tomato juice and enhances its flavor. These juices are then mixed with our olive oil to form a simple dressing.
- Feta cheese: I like to add a lot of sheep cheese to this salad. When you push the forks into them, they crash and mix in the salad. Mozzarella or Mexican cheese is also great.

How to Make My Favorite Cherry Tomato Salad
The key to this cherry tomato salad is to give salt and tomato together before adding anything else. Their own flavor is great, but after I let the tomatoes add a little salt, they are incredible. Their sweetness and flavor are intensified. (I also use this tip for the best bruschetta!)
When you prepare a salad, add a little sour. Recently, I’ve been fascinated by champagne vinegar, but red wine vinegar or balsamic vinegar with cherry tomatoes are great.
As a nod to the Greek salad, I added a piece of sheep cheese. Then I sprinkled some oregano and pepper on the top and drizzled with high quality olive oil. Simple, fresh and delicious. Do this as soon as possible. I know you will like it!


Simple Cherry Tomato Salad
This cherry tomato salad recipe is undeniable, but that doesn’t mean it won’t shock you. Marinate the tomatoes for at least 10 minutes to enhance their sweetness and flavor. We call for cherry tomatoes, but all sizes will work.
Make 2 servings
You will need
2 cups of cherry tomatoes, about 10 oz
1/4 teaspoon fine sea salt
1 teaspoon vinegar, such as red wine, champagne or champagne vinegar or use fresh lemon juice
2 oz of sheep cheese, cut into large plates
1/4 teaspoon dried oregano
Generous fresh pepper
1 tablespoon extra olive oil
direction
1Cut the tomatoes in half or quarter so they are in all shapes and sizes.
2Add to the bowl and add salt. Leave for at least 10 minutes.
3Stir in the vinegar and paste the feta cheese board in a pile of tomatoes.
4Sprinkle oregano and black pepper on top.
5Finish with drizzle of olive oil.
Adam and Joanne’s Tips
- Storage: It is best to eat on the day you make it, but it will be stored in the refrigerator for a day or two.
